Elmhurst University Admission Chances

Quick answer

Elmhurst University in Elmhurst, IL admits about 74% of applicants (admitted students score 990–1260 on the SAT, middle 50%), making it a target-to-safety for students near its published range for most students. Key facts

Acceptance rate
74%
SAT (mid-50%)
990–1260
Test policy
Test-optional
In-state tuition
$42,955
Out-of-state tuition
$42,955
Avg. net price
$24,185
Undergrads
3,006
Setting
Suburban
Location
Elmhurst, IL
